#### Factors Affecting RO Membrane Price

1. **Brand and Quality**
– The price of an RO membrane largely depends on the brand and quality. Well-known brands like Kent, Aquaguard, and Pureit often have higher prices due to their reputation for quality and reliability.

2. **Capacity and Compatibility**
– RO membranes come in different capacities, typically measured in gallons per day (GPD). The higher the capacity, the more water the membrane can filter, which may increase the cost. Additionally, some membranes are designed for specific RO purifier models, which can also affect the price.

3. **Technology and Features**
– Advanced RO membranes that include features like high TDS (Total Dissolved Solids) rejection rates, anti-bacterial properties, or enhanced durability will generally cost more. Innovations in filtration technology also contribute to price variations.

4. **Market Demand and Availability**
– Prices can fluctuate based on market demand, availability, and supply chain factors. During peak seasons or in regions where water purification is crucial, RO membrane prices may be higher.

Tips for Buying an RO Membrane

– **Check Compatibility**: Ensure the membrane you choose is compatible with your RO system model.
– **Consider Your Water Quality**: If you live in an area with high TDS or contamination, invest in a high-quality membrane.
– **Warranty and After-Sales Support**: Opt for membranes that come with a warranty and reliable customer support.
